Graphics Processing Unit Upgrades

The graphics processing unit remains the foundation of game performance, directly influencing frame rates, visual fidelity, and overall gaming experience. Contemporary games demand increasingly capable graphics processors to provide smooth performance at high resolution and frame rates. Upgrading to a contemporary graphics card—whether an NVIDIA RTX 40-series or AMD Radeon RX 7000-series—can substantially enhance gaming performance. These latest designs offer superior ray tracing capabilities, DLSS 3 technology, and enhanced memory bandwidth, enabling you to run demanding titles at maximum settings whilst sustaining competitive frame rates that are essential for competitive gaming.

When selecting a GPU upgrade, take into account your desired screen resolution and refresh rate. A 1440p 144Hz setup generally needs a mid-range card like the RTX 4070, whilst 4K gaming requires high-end cards such as the RTX 4090. Furthermore, verify your power supply unit can support the new GPU’s power needs—many contemporary graphics cards require 750W or greater. Examining performance data and reviews specific to your favourite games will assist in identifying which GPU offers the strongest value for money for your particular gaming priorities and budget constraints.

Central Processing Unit and Memory Requirements

The CPU and RAM form the backbone of game performance, directly influencing frame rates, loading times, and system responsiveness overall. Today’s games require more multi-core CPUs capable of handling complex physics simulations and AI computations. Moving to a modern processor can resolve bottleneck issues that prevent your graphics card from operating at full capacity, whilst adequate memory provides smooth performance without performance stuttering and dips during demanding scenarios.

Memory Capacity and Performance

Most serious gamers should aim for a baseline of 32GB RAM, as this amount has emerged as the norm for competitive gaming and creative work. With 16GB proving inadequate for modern titles, particularly those with sprawling environments or detailed graphical assets, the upgrade to 32GB provides substantial headroom for multitasking. Additionally, faster RAM speeds—particularly DDR5 modules running at 6000MHz or higher—deliver measurable performance improvements in frame rates and responsiveness, warranting the expenditure for serious performers.

Beyond raw capacity, RAM speed and response time significantly impact gaming performance, especially in competitive titles where every millisecond counts. DDR5 memory offers superior bandwidth compared to its DDR4 predecessor, enabling quicker data movement between your processor and system memory. When choosing RAM modules, focus on modules with low CAS latency ratings and proven compatibility with your motherboard, guaranteeing stable operation and performance across prolonged gaming periods.

The decision between DDR4 and DDR5 is largely determined by your existing system setup and financial limitations. Whilst DDR5 embodies the next-generation standard, DDR4 continues to be suitable for gaming purposes, especially if you already possess compatible hardware. However, fresh system builds should favour DDR5 systems, as they offer better longevity and will support increasingly demanding games over the next several years without needing additional memory expansion.

Selecting quality RAM supplied by well-known suppliers guarantees dependability and durability, vital considerations for preserving consistent gaming performance. Consider purchasing RAM kits with RGB illumination if aesthetics matter to you, though speed isn’t influenced by aesthetic additions. In the end, emphasising RAM capacity and speed paired with a modern processor builds a solid platform for outstanding gameplay and future-proofs your expenditure.

Cooling and Storage Solutions

Storage performance has become increasingly critical for current gaming needs. Upgrading to an NVMe SSD markedly cuts game loading times and enhances overall system responsiveness. A large-capacity storage device (at least 1TB) ensures you can maintain a substantial gaming library without constant deletions. Additionally, quicker drive speeds translates to smoother texture streaming and faster level loading, providing a measurable performance edge in fast-paced titles.

Thermal management is equally vital for sustained operation during intensive gaming periods. Investing in premium case cooling fans, aftermarket CPU coolers, or water cooling systems prevents thermal throttling and maintains peak clock speeds. Proper cooling extends hardware longevity whilst enabling more secure overclocking potential. Consider your case’s cooling design and improve cooling fans accordingly—maintaining heat levels below 80°C ensures your components perform at peak efficiency throughout heavy gameplay periods.
